Why Your Software Sucks: Inheritance
Deep inheritance hierarchies create ‘everything touches everything’ architectures that resist change and accumulate technical debt. Here’s why inheritance is the gateway drug to frameworkism.
Deep inheritance hierarchies create ‘everything touches everything’ architectures that resist change and accumulate technical debt. Here’s why inheritance is the gateway drug to frameworkism.